E-commerce SEO manages search performance across a catalogue rather than a set of pages. The defining constraint is scale: problems occur at template level, affect thousands of URLs at once, and are usually about which pages should exist at all rather than how any one of them is written.

Because the unit of work is the template, not the page. A single category template governs thousands of URLs, so one decision propagates instantly across the catalogue. The central question is index management — which pages should exist, be indexable and be crawled — rather than how any individual page reads.
Faceted navigation is where this most commonly goes wrong, and the failure is spectacular when it does. Filters that generate crawlable URLs produce combinatorial explosions — colour by size by brand by availability — and a catalogue of ten thousand products can generate millions of near-duplicate URLs that consume crawl budget and rank for nothing.
The second recurring problem is that most e-commerce revenue ranks on category pages, not product pages, while most optimisation effort goes into products. Category pages target the terms with real demand; product pages target long-tail terms with high intent and low volume. Both matter, and the effort is usually distributed backwards.
Then there is the lifecycle problem nobody plans for. Products go out of stock, get discontinued, or are replaced by a newer model. Each of those is a decision — keep, redirect, consolidate or remove — and stores that never made the decision accumulate thousands of dead URLs that dilute the catalogue and frustrate visitors.
Thin and duplicate content is the fourth, and it is largely structural. Manufacturer descriptions used verbatim across every retailer selling the same item, variant pages differing by one attribute, and category pages with nothing but a product grid all produce pages engines have little reason to rank. That is fixable at template level, not one page at a time.

The differences here are structural rather than tactical. Ordinary SEO improves pages one at a time; catalogue SEO decides the rules that generate thousands. That makes index management the central discipline, and makes mistakes proportionally more expensive when they propagate across a catalogue.
| Ordinary SEO | Catalogue SEO | |
|---|---|---|
| Unit of work | The page | The template that generates thousands |
| Central question | How should this page be written | Which pages should exist at all |
| Biggest risk | A page underperforming | Faceting generating millions of URLs |
| Where revenue ranks | Wherever the page targets | Mostly category pages, not products |
| Content problem | Thin writing | Manufacturer copy duplicated across every retailer |
| Lifecycle | Rarely an issue | Stock, discontinuation and supersession need a rule |
You need this when Search Console reports far more URLs than you have products, when filter combinations are indexable, when discontinued products return errors or empty pages, or when product descriptions are manufacturer copy identical to every competitor selling the same item.
Index and faceting fixes usually show fastest, because reclaiming crawl budget lets engines reach pages they were previously spending their time away from. Category strategy takes longer and typically produces the larger revenue effect, since that is where the commercial demand concentrates.
